If you're an experienced Broker Manager with a background in Asset Finance, this is an opportunity to take ownership of a well-defined territory while joining a growing specialist lender with ambitious plans.
You'll have the autonomy to develop broker relationships across Scotland and make a genuine commercial impact.
This is a relationship-led role where your expertise in broker management and business development will be valued.
Working remotely, you'll focus on building long-term introducer partnerships, generating new business opportunities, and structuring asset finance solutions for business customers.
Package & Benefits • Salary £55,000 to £60,000 per annum. • Performance-related bonus. • Remote working.
About the Company You will be joining a growing specialist asset finance lender focused on supporting UK businesses through intermediary and broker relationships.
The business is committed to building long-term partnerships and delivering flexible funding solutions through a relationship-driven approach.
Key Responsibilities
- Develop and manage broker relationships across Scotland, with a focus on growing Tier 2 introducer partnerships.
- Generate new hard asset finance opportunities and maintain a strong pipeline of business through intermediary channels.
- Structure and negotiate asset finance solutions for business customers from initial enquiry through to completion.
- Represent the business within the broker and asset finance market while delivering a consistently high level of service.
About You
- Proven experience within Asset Finance, Leasing, or Commercial Finance.
- Strong broker management and business development experience, ideally with exposure to hard asset finance.
- Existing broker relationships within Scotland would be advantageous.
